快速构建计划管理系统的方法包括以下几个步骤:
1. 明确目标和需求:在开始构建计划管理系统之前,需要明确系统的目标和需求。这包括确定要实现的功能、性能指标、用户角色和权限等。通过与相关利益相关者进行沟通和讨论,确保对需求有清晰的理解和共识。
2. 选择合适的技术栈:根据项目的规模、预算和技术团队的能力,选择合适的开发技术和工具。常见的技术栈包括Java、Python、C#等编程语言,以及如MySQL、MongoDB、Redis等数据库技术。此外,还可以考虑使用一些开源框架或工具,如Spring Boot、Docker等,以提高开发效率和可维护性。
3. 设计系统架构:根据项目需求和功能模块,设计系统的架构。通常采用分层的系统架构,将系统分为数据层、业务逻辑层和表示层。数据层负责存储和管理数据;业务逻辑层负责处理业务逻辑和规则;表示层负责与用户进行交互,展示系统界面。
4. 编写代码实现功能:根据系统架构,编写代码实现各个功能模块。在编写代码时,遵循编码规范和最佳实践,提高代码的可读性和可维护性。同时,注意代码的模块化和可重用性,以便于后续的扩展和维护。
5. 测试和调试:在开发过程中,不断进行单元测试、集成测试和系统测试,确保代码的正确性和稳定性。对于发现的问题和缺陷,及时进行修复和优化。此外,还需要关注性能优化和安全性问题,确保系统能够满足实际需求。
6. 部署和上线:完成系统开发和测试后,选择合适的部署环境和工具,将系统部署到生产环境中。在部署过程中,注意备份数据和配置文件,防止意外情况导致的数据丢失。同时,还需关注系统的监控和报警机制,确保系统能够及时发现并处理异常情况。
7. 持续优化和更新:随着项目的运行和使用,可能会遇到新的需求和问题。因此,需要定期对系统进行评估和优化,根据实际需求进行调整和更新。同时,也需要关注技术的发展趋势,引入新的技术和工具,提高系统的竞争力。
总之,快速构建计划管理系统需要明确目标和需求、选择合适的技术栈、设计系统架构、编写代码实现功能、测试和调试、部署和上线以及持续优化和更新等步骤。只有通过这些步骤的合理规划和实施,才能构建出一个高效、稳定且易于维护的计划管理系统。